#5220ef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5220ef is composed of 32.2% red, 12.5%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 86.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 254.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 53.1%. #5220ef color hex could be obtained by blending #a440ff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#5220ef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04010f is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5220ef

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#86858a is the less saturated color, while #4d17f8 is the most saturated one.
